NAME
wajig - Simplified command line administrator for Debian SYNOPSIS
wajig [options] commands... DESCRIPTION
This manual page briefly documents the wajig command. wajig packages into one tool many commands useful for managing a Debian system. Instead of having to remember whether to use dpkg or apt- get or apt-cache, etc, wajig does the selection of the appropriate tool for you. wajig is a user command but will use sudo to run commands requiring super user permissions. The primary documentation is available from http://www.togaware.com/wajig. OPTIONS
This program follows the usual GNU command line syntax, with long options starting with two dashes (`-'). A summary of options to get you started is included below. For more details see wajig tutorial and wajig commands. -h, --help Show summary. -V, --version Show version of program. AUTHOR
